Knee walls and purlins have distinct roles in a structural system, particularly in roof construction.

Knee walls are short, vertical walls that typically support the ends of rafters, especially in a building's attic space or in areas with sloped roofs. Their function is crucial in transferring loads from the roof down to the foundational structure, thereby providing additional support and stability. By connecting the rafters to the floor or ceiling framework, knee walls help in maintaining the integrity of the roof structure.

Purlins, on the other hand, are horizontal members that run perpendicular to the rafters and provide support for sheathing or roofing materials. They distribute loads from the roof sheeting to the rafters and help create a more stable structure. By running along the rafters, they enhance the strength of the roof system and allow for efficient load transfer.

The differentiation in their functions highlights the complementary roles that knee walls and purlins play in ensuring the safety and stability of a building's roof.
